Renault’s Koleos receives a five-star safety rating

The latest generation of the large SUV gained the rating from Euro NCAP, the continent’s most respected safety testers

The Renault Koleos has been awarded a five-star safety rating by Euro NCAP following a stringent testing process.

The second generation of the large SUV has an extensive range of both active and passive safety systems that help to keep you on the road.

In the four main categories tested, the Koleos scored more than 60 per cent in all of them, including 90% in adult protection, 79% in child safety and 73% for assistance systems.

Engineered with a high-strength steel passenger structure, the Koleos also comes with adaptive airbags that inflate to a certain size depending on the force of the impact.

Other passive systems include anti-whiplash headrests, anti-submarining front seats – which maintain their structure in an impact – and Isofix points on the rear bench of seats.

Active safety systems fitted as standard include active city emergency braking, lane departure warning, blind spot warning and traffic sign recognition. Active cruise control also comes as standard.

Other systems available include a rear-view camera, all-around parking sensors and automatic high/low beam control. Hands-free parking can be fitted as an optional extra, where the car takes control of the steering and the driver only has to control the throttle and brake.

Koleos models fitted with the top-end diesel engine comes with four-wheel-drive that can be turned off when not needed and offers better traction in slippery conditions.

Prices for the Koleos start from £27,500.
